Iron Man Sabah

Yohan Charles Jayasuriya is a Sabahan cosplayer who likes to cosplay different characters for events or private functions. He is also a freelance DJ and emcee, sound, light and karaoke supplier, and talent as well as clown services provider. Well, it’s safe to say that he’s a multitasker when it comes to event entertainment.

Recently, he went up the 4,101-metre mountain as a part of the 10th annual Mt. Kinabalu expedition, held by an NGO called Coalition Duchenne.

(Credit: Coalition Duchenne, Danny Ho / Facebook)

This was apparently his second time ascending the mountain in his full Iron Man costume.

The first time was back in July 2020, but it was a failed attempt. Minus this, he had already climbed the mountain 11 times successfully, both for fun and some for competitions.

This time around, he finally completed his quest and he also did it to support Duchenne syndrome or DMD, a genetic disorder that affects the muscles, prevalent in young boys.

This climb was actually to create awareness for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y.

At the same time, it was a chance for me to finally complete the attempt that I set out to do back in July 2020, which is to be the first cosplayer in my ironman suit to climb Mount Kinabalu from the start to summit and back.

The only instances where I took off my ironman suit were during meal times, bathroom breaks and sleep.

Yohan Charles Jayasuriya to TRP

Besides creating awareness of the disease, he also hopes for his achievement to be in the Malaysian Book Of Records.

What is DMD?

Duchenne muscular dystrophy (DMD) is a genetic disease that occurs primarily in males (may affect females too in rare cases) and affects the muscles. It starts early in their childhood and muscles get weak and worsen (less flexible) over time.

Coalition Duchenne is a non-profit organization that raises global awareness and funding for Duchenne muscular dystrophy through donations and various annual fundraising events. They have done multiple expeditions on Mount Kinabalu before and this is their 10th time doing so.
